I am lazy right now, so I use hummingbird feed


My local family owned feed store has a huge bag and it is cheap.

I have two glass and two plastic. I really do not understand why I have the plastic ones but must of found them with last move.

I like to have at least two feeders since the males will guard the hell out of them.

I prefer glass because they clean easier. The biggest thing is to make sure they have a perch. My cheap plastic ones do not have perch so I have them under my grape vine and the other two are on my deck.

I find that if you can give them a good deal of shade, preferably protecting from the after noon heat at minimum, they attract better.

I have a consistent 7 here right now that have no problems drinking as I have my drink on the deck two feet away.

I am going through 32 ounces every 5 days.
